Output 4be322702d107bd9fed9fa4a694d21eb98132aa92fd20974be47ce5d93f92565:2

value
356309852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11dab26668bfc5994229c5949b84ada8ed355c87 OP_EQUAL
address
33KRQ8W526WhAyQa9eCcK2cirETytjRmVu
transaction
4be322702d107bd9fed9fa4a694d21eb98132aa92fd20974be47ce5d93f92565
confirmations
309706
spent
true